A significant cause of the Great Depression was that:_____.
a. a decrease in protective tariffs had opened American business to competition from abroad.
b. some banking policies were unsound and had led to the overuse of credit.
c. consumer goods were relatively inexpensive.
d. a wave of violent strikes had paralyzed the major industries.

Explanation:

The causes of the Great Depression included the stock market crash of 1929, bank failures, and a drought that lasted throughout the 1930s. During this time, the nation faced high unemployment, people lost their homes and possessions, and nearly half of American banks closed.
